IP查询
查询
你查询的IP:[59.172.31.240] 地理位置:中国–湖北–武汉电信
最新查询
123.178.155.8
119.3.77.38
125.98.142.12
116.215.127.2
59.191.202.21
121.59.75.242
59.80.191.162
211.64.96.222
119.60.60.240
116.16.254.45
59.172.31.240
58.87.64.232
116.128.188.99
202.127.112.254
122.119.208.206
203.174.96.1
123.52.193.156
122.119.85.167
118.132.174.3
116.52.235.47
202.38.176.191
221.176.141.107
221.12.80.242
202.127.112.134
123.253.41.199
125.96.0.193
59.108.63.252
222.192.30.144
202.70.98.94
123.160.222.140
210.72.24.208
123.232.163.227